At 162,330 gross tons, Wedyan is the 558th largest of the 84,014 vessels in this registry that report a tonnage. The median across that set is 5,994 GT, so this hull is about 27 times the typical vessel on record here. The largest measures 499,167 GT.
Among the 58,086 vessels this registry holds no type classification for held here, it ranks 253rd by tonnage — larger than 99% of that group. Their median tonnage is 5,358 GT, and the largest tenth begin at 54,309 GT. The flag most often flown by this group is Panama (5,698 ships). Its IMO number, 9524970, carries its own check digit. The first six digits are weighted seven down to two and summed — 9×7 + 5×6 + 2×5 + 4×4 + 9×3 + 7×2 = 160 — and the last digit of that total, 0, must equal the seventh digit, 0. It does, so this number is well formed.
